Transaction 93358b651739d605daadf0e4d97bc5c2b08ba0158aaf7fcda6c7bc2360367da8
1 Input
1 Output
-
93358b651739d605daadf0e4d97bc5c2b08ba0158aaf7fcda6c7bc2360367da8:0
- value
- 3588448
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27249e278fb76e6794eb45df1457f36daa28357e OP_EQUAL
- address
- 35Fz9GqZgK6HxRrwHAePasS35rZqmk8DTg